Princeton University engineers have developed a device that may change the way that we power many of our smaller gadgets and devices. They have created a small chip that can capture and harness our natural body movement,  creating enough energy to power small devices that are electronic, such as cell phone or pacemaker. The largest solar-powered boat in the world is set to launch. The catamaran PlanetSolar enjoys stats are: weight: 60-ton, a 470-square-meter are covered by 38,000 solar cells to generate 103.4 kW of energy. 18 million euro ($24.4 million) was spent to adorn this beauty in environmentally friendly way.
